ASSEMBLY
- Assemble in the reverse order of disassembly indicated in the illustration, referring to the following notes:
Spring And Ball (23)
1. Insert the spring and ball (5th/reverse) into the bearing housing.
2. Press down the spring and ball (5th/reverse) by using the SST and a screwdriver, and install the shift rod.
5th/Reverse Shift Fork And Rod (21, 22)
^ Install the 5th/reverse shift fork and 5th/reverse shift rod into the bearing housing.
Interlock Pin (18)
1. Position the interlock pin into the bearing housing by using the SSTs.
2. Verify that the interlock pin is correctly installed.
1st/2nd And 3rd/4th Shift Fork And Rod, Interlock Pin (12, 14, 16, 17)
1. Set the 1st/2nd shift fork onto the 1st/2nd clutch hub component.
2. Install the 3rd/4th shift fork and 3rd/4th shift rod, and install the interlock pin into the bearing housing as described in the interlock pin assembly note.
Spring, Clip (9, 10)
1. Slide the spring onto the 5th/Reverse shift rod. While pressing the spring, install a new clip.
2. Install new clips to the 3rd/4th shift rod and 1st/2nd shift rod.
3. Verify that the centers of the shift fork and clutch hub sleeve are aligned properly. If they are not, select the proper washer to install between 1st gear and the mainshaft front bearing, and between reverse gear and the mainshaft front bearing.
4. The following washer thicknesses are available. The total thickness of the front and rear washers should be following. Total thickness is 5.9 - 6.0 mm (0.232 - 0.236 inch). Washer thickness are 2.2 mm (0.087 inch), 2.7 mm (0.106 inch), 3.0 mm ( 0.118 inch), 3.2 mm (0.126 inch), 3.7 mm (0.146 inch).
